Four different position groups are being hit by a defection this offseason in Columbia, as the Missouri football program has reportedly suffered three transfers and a retirement.

According to Gabe DeArmond of PowerMizzou.com, linebacker T.J. Warren, receiver Raymond Wingo and defensive back Jerod Alton are all leaving the football team via transfer. Offensive lineman Pompey Coleman is also expected to retire from the sport.

Warren was the only player of the four listed on the two-deep for the Tigers in the 2017 season finale against Arkansas.
